International Business Image Improvement Month
About
May brings with it the opportunity to celebrate International Business Image Improvement Month, a time dedicated to enhancing the perceptions and representations of businesses across the globe. This observance encourages organizations, both big and small, to assess and elevate their public image, fostering positive relationships with clients, stakeholders, and the broader community. It's a moment for businesses to reflect on their branding, communication strategies, and overall presence, ensuring they resonate with their audience in meaningful ways.
Throughout the month, companies are invited to engage in activities that promote a polished and professional image. This can include updating marketing materials, refining customer service practices, or even investing in employee training to ensure that every team member embodies the brand values. International Business Image Improvement Month serves as a reminder that a strong, positive image not only attracts customers but also builds trust and loyalty. As we honor this month, let's embrace the chance to take our business identities to new heights, fostering a culture of excellence and integrity in every interaction.
